Tracking India's Progress on Addressing Malnutrition

28 May 2021
Adolescent Health

by P Menon, R Avula, E Sarswat, S Mani, M Jangid, S Kaur, A Singh, A K Dubey, S Gupta, D Nair, P Agarwal, N Agrawal 60 MIN READ

This study covers issues requiring a consideration in strengthening efforts to improve availability and use of data generated through the POSHAN Abhiyaan, India’s National Nutrition Mission. It examines the availability of data across a range of initiatives under the POSHAN Abhiyaan framework, including population-based surveys and administrative data systems. To improve monitoring and data usage, this document focuses on three questions: what type of indicators should be used; what type of data sources can be used; and with what frequency should progress on different indicator domains be assessed. The paper provides guidance for national, state, and district-level government officials and stakeholders for using data to track progress on nutrition interventions, immediate and underlying determinants, and outcomes.
